The shadow zone refers to the area on the Earth's surface where seismic waves, specifically P-waves and S-waves, do not arrive after an earthquake. This phenomenon occurs due to the refraction and reflection of seismic waves as they pass through different layers of the Earth's internal structure, such as the crust, mantle, and outer core. Understanding shadow zones helps scientists gain insights into the composition and behavior of the Earth's layers, revealing how seismic waves interact with varying materials.
